Python是一种流行的编程语言,以其简单易用、快速开发和可扩展性而闻名。Python拥有众多库和模块,其中之一是波浪线函数模块。
import math import matplotlib.pyplot as plt def sine_wave(x_values): y_values = [] for x in x_values: y = math.sin(x) y_values.append(y) return y_values x_values = [i / 100.0 for i in range(0, 700)] y_values = sine_wave(x_values) plt.plot(x_values, y_values) plt.show()
该代码段使用了math和matplotlib库,绘制了一个正弦波形。我们首先定义了一个sine_wave函数,该函数接受一个x值列表,并返回对应的y值列表。然后我们创建了一个x值列表,该列表是0到6.99之间的浮点数,每个数都增加了0.01。我们还创建了一个y值列表,将sine_wave函数应用于x_values并返回结果。最后,我们使用matplotlib的plot函数将x_values和y_values传递给它,并使用show函数显示图形。
Python的波浪线函数模块可以让我们轻松地生成各种波形,这是实现信号处理、音频处理和图形处理等应用程序的强大工具。